Explanation of acne and its causes. How acne affects skin appearance and health.Acne is like an uninvited guest that shows up at the worst times! It happens when hair follicles become clogged with oil and dead skin. Factors like hormones, stress, and even what you eat can increase your chances of breaking out. Acne affects your skin’s appearance, often leaving behind spots and scars. This can really hurt your confidence. Remember, clear skin makes us feel like rock stars! Which Ingredients Should I Look For In Products To Help With Acne And Promote A Radiant Complexion?Look for ingredients like salicylic acid, which helps clear up acne. You can also use benzoyl peroxide to fight bacteria. For a radiant glow, find products with vitamin C. Aloe vera is great too; it soothes your skin. Always check if the product suits your skin type!

Are There Any Specific Moisturizing Products That Can Hydrate My Skin Without Causing Breakouts?Yes, you can try using products that say “oil-free” or “non-comedogenic,” which means they won’t block your pores. Look for moisturizers with water, aloe vera, or hyaluronic acid. These ingredients help your skin stay moist without causing bumps. Always test a little on your skin first to make sure it feels good!
